What are some common challenges faced by part-time data annotation professionals, and how can they be managed?

Part-time data annotation professionals often encounter challenges such as repetitive tasks, maintaining concentration over extended periods, and understanding nuanced annotation guidelines. To manage these challenges, it's helpful to take regular short breaks, stay organized with clear labeling conventions, and communicate proactively with team leads or project managers when questions arise. Many teams also provide regular training updates and feedback sessions, which support continuous improvement and help annotators stay aligned with project requirements.

What are Data Annotation Part Time jobs?

Data annotation part time jobs involve labeling or tagging data—such as images, text, audio, or video—to help train machine learning models. This work can include identifying objects in photos, transcribing audio, or categorizing content. Part time positions offer flexible hours and may be remote, making them a popular choice for students or those looking to supplement their income. Attention to detail and the ability to follow guidelines are important skills for these roles.

Does data annotation actually pay?

Data annotation jobs typically pay hourly or per task rates, with wages varying depending on the platform, complexity of the work, and experience level. Many part-time data annotation roles offer minimum wage or slightly above, and some platforms provide flexible schedules for remote work. Payment is generally reliable if working through reputable companies or platforms that process payments regularly.

What is the difference between Data Annotation Part Time vs Data Labeling Specialist?

AspectData Annotation Part TimeData Labeling Specialist
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skillsHigh school diploma; attention to detail
Work EnvironmentRemote or office-based; flexible hoursRemote or office; often project-based
Industry UsageAI, machine learning, data processingAI, machine learning, data processing
Job FocusAnnotating data for training AI modelsLabeling data to improve model accuracy

Data Annotation Part Time and Data Labeling Specialist roles are similar, focusing on preparing data for AI training. The main difference lies in terminology; 'Data Annotation' emphasizes the process, while 'Data Labeling' refers to the task. Both roles typically require similar skills and work environments, making them interchangeable in many contexts.

OVERVIEW

Welocalize is an award-winning localization and data transformation company. We are currently building one of the world's largest Internet Rating Programs and want you to join!  

As a Spanish Search Quality Rater, you will review and grade internet content to help online engines work better. In other words, you'll tell the engine how good or bad it is performing based on user keywords.  

You will complete tasks in Spanish.

This role is great for people who:  

  • Surf the internet daily  
  • Use major search engines frequently  
  • Know what people want based on a few keywords  
  • Enjoy researching topics online  

Project Details

  • Job Title: Search Quality Rater
  • Location: US-based, Remote/home office/work from home - Note: Even though the position is remote, you must reside in the country that is noted in this description. This will be automatically checked during the hiring process. 
  • Hours: Minimum 10 hours per week, up to 29 hours per week; set your own schedule
  • Start date: ASAP
  • Employment Type: W2 Part-Time Employee, payment every 2 weeks
  • Longevity of project: 12 months (with possibility of extension).

This work is based on project needs. Weekly hours may vary.

Currently hiring in: Alabama, Florida, Georgia, Indiana, Kansas, Kentucky ,Missouri ,Montana, New Hampshire, North Carolina, Ohio, Oklahoma, Pennsylvania ,South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as, Utah, Virginia, West Virginia, Wisconsin.

Applicants must be of at least 18 years of age to apply.

Qualifications
  • Fluent in both Spanish and English (written and spoken)  
  • Strong understanding of pop culture in the target locale  
  • Reliable computer system and internet connection  
  • Familiar understanding of how to use online search engines  
  • Sign a standard Non-Disclosure Agreement and Service Level Agreement
